Closed Bug 1684805 Opened 3 years ago Closed 3 years ago

Dropdown Menu returns to first item automatically after selecting another item

Categories

(Core :: Layout: Form Controls, defect)

Firefox 84
Desktop
Linux
defect

Tracking

()

RESOLVED WORKSFORME
Tracking Status
firefox-esr78 --- wontfix
firefox84 --- wontfix
firefox85 --- wontfix
firefox86 --- affected
firefox87 --- fixed

People

(Reporter: yuilytg7, Unassigned)

References

Details

Attachments

(1 file)

User Agent: Mozilla/5.0 (X11; Ubuntu; Linux x86_64; rv:84.0) Gecko/20100101 Firefox/84.0

Steps to reproduce:

  1. Go to https://www.nvidia.com/Download/index.aspx
  2. In the Dropdown Menu "Product Type" select "Geforce"
  3. In the Dropdown Menu "Product Series" select anything other than the first element

Actual results:

The selection goes automatically back to the first element (Geforce RTX 30 Series)

Expected results:

The selection should stay at what the user selected

Attached video shows bug

Component: Untriaged → Layout: Form Controls
Product: Firefox → Core

I can reproduce the issue on Nightly86.0a1 Ubuntu20.04, but not on Windows10.

OS: Unspecified → Linux
Hardware: Unspecified → Desktop

I can also reproduce the issue on Chromium 87 ubuntu20.04.

(In reply to Alice0775 White from comment #3)

I can also reproduce the issue on Chromium 87 ubuntu20.04.

No repro Google Chrome Version 87.0.4280.88 (Official Build) (64-bit)

Kubuntu 20.10

(In reply to Alice0775 White from comment #3)

I can also reproduce the issue on Chromium 87 ubuntu20.04.

I am NOT able to reproduce it on Chromium Version 87.0.4280.88 (Official Build) snap (64-bit). Kubuntu 20.10.

I don't know why you can reproduce it on Chromium and me not.

However it looks definitively a bug of Firefox and not of the website.

Interestingly,
On Ubuntu20.04 64bit: The problem is also reproduced with Chrome 87.0.4280.88: https://youtu.be/VrbnE01kX_I
However,
On Linux Mint 19 cinnamon: I can't reproduce the problem with Nightly86 and Chrome87.

GTK version of Ubuntu20.04:

ububtu20:~$ dpkg -l libgtk* | grep -e '^i' | grep -e 'libgtk-*[0-9]'
ii  libgtk-3-0:amd64           3.24.20-0ubuntu1 amd64        GTK graphical user interface library
ii  libgtk-3-bin               3.24.20-0ubuntu1 amd64        programs for the GTK graphical user interface library
ii  libgtk-3-common            3.24.20-0ubuntu1 all          common files for the GTK graphical user interface library
ii  libgtk2.0-0:amd64          2.24.32-4ubuntu4 amd64        GTK graphical user interface library - old version
ii  libgtk2.0-bin              2.24.32-4ubuntu4 amd64        programs for the GTK graphical user interface library
ii  libgtk2.0-common           2.24.32-4ubuntu4 all          common files for the GTK graphical user interface library
ii  libgtk3-perl               0.037-1          all          Perl bindings for the GTK+ graphical user interface library

GTK version of Linux Mint 19 cinnamon:

linux-mint:~$ dpkg -l libgtk* | grep -e '^i' | grep -e 'libgtk-*[0-9]'
ii  libgtk-3-0:amd64             3.22.30-1ubuntu4  amd64        GTK+ graphical user interface library
ii  libgtk-3-bin                 3.22.30-1ubuntu4  amd64        programs for the GTK+ graphical user interface library
ii  libgtk-3-common              3.22.30-1ubuntu4  all          common files for the GTK+ graphical user interface library
ii  libgtk-3-dev:amd64           3.22.30-1ubuntu4  amd64        development files for the GTK+ library
ii  libgtk2-perl                 2:1.24992-1build1 amd64        Perl interface to the 2.x series of the Gimp Toolkit library
ii  libgtk2.0-0:amd64            2.24.32-1ubuntu1  amd64        GTK+ graphical user interface library
ii  libgtk2.0-bin                2.24.32-1ubuntu1  amd64        programs for the GTK+ graphical user interface library
ii  libgtk2.0-cil                2.12.40-2         amd64        CLI binding for the GTK+ toolkit 2.12
ii  libgtk2.0-common             2.24.32-1ubuntu1  all          common files for the GTK+ graphical user interface library
ii  libgtk2.0-dev                2.24.32-1ubuntu1  amd64        development files for the GTK+ library
ii  libgtk3-perl                 0.032-1           all          Perl bindings for the GTK+ graphical user interface library

Mozilla/5.0 (X11; Ubuntu; Linux x86_64; rv:84.0) Gecko/20100101 Firefox/84.0

Hi,

I have managed to reproduce the issue in release 84.0.2, beta 85.0b6 and latest nightly 86.0a1 (2021-01-07) on Ubuntu 18.04. The issue is also reproducible in Fx61 (build id: 20180506100126). Not reproducible in Chrome, using the same OS (Ubuntu 18.04).

Severity: -- → S3
Status: UNCONFIRMED → NEW
Ever confirmed: true
Status: NEW → RESOLVED
Closed: 3 years ago
Depends on: 1560824
Resolution: --- → WORKSFORME
You need to log in before you can comment on or make changes to this bug.

Attachment

General

Creator:
Created:
Updated:
Size: